Sri Krishna Institute of Technology (SKIT), established in 2001, is a private engineering institution in Chikkabanavara, Bangalore, Karnataka, run by Sri Raghavendra Educational Institutions Society (SREIS). Affiliated to Visvesvaraya Technological University (VTU), Belagavi, and approved by the All India Council for Technical Education (AICTE), Shri Krishna Institute of Technology is accredited by NAAC, NBA for its B.E. programs, placed in the NIRF Engineering Rankings (201-300 band), and has an Internal Quality Assurance Cell (IQAC) for academic achievement. Shri Krishna Institute of Technology provides 4-year B.E. programs in Civil Engineering, Computer Science and Engineering, Information Science & Engineering,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ning, Electronics and Communication Engineering, and Mechanical Engineering with an intake of 480 students. The institute is focused on producing globally competitive engineers through innovation and research.
Shri Krishna Institute of Technology’s Training and Placement Cell achieves the highest package of INR 8 LPA, with recruiters like TCS, Infosys, and Wipro, supported by training programs like Infosys Campus Connect and 300-hour JAVA training with NASCOM certifications. The lush green campus features advanced laboratories, a library with 25,200 books, Wi-Fi, and sports facilities. Admission is merit-based through KCET, COMEDK UGET, or JEE Main, with management quota seats available. Shri Krishna Institute of Technology offers state and central government scholarships and fee concessions for eligible students.

Shri Krishna Institute of Technology Courses & Fees 2025
Shri Krishna Institute of Technology provides six programs of B.E., focusing on industry-specific skills. The fees are between INR 2,00,000 and INR 7,44,444 for the 4-year program, based on the admission category (KCET, COMEDK, or management).
Shri Krishna Institute of Technology Admission Process 2025
Admissions into Shri Krishna Institute of Technology's B.E. courses are merit-based through KCET, COMEDK UGET, or JEE Main, and counselling is done by Karnataka Examinations Authority (KEA) or COMEDK. The candidates must have 45% in 10+2 (40% for the reserved category). Management quota seats are also available for direct admission. Offline applications with forms available for download on the website.
How to apply?
- Download the application form from the website of Shri Krishna Institute of Technology or contact the admission office.
- Fill the form with information such as name, academic records, and entrance test scores.
- Enclose documents (10th/12th marksheets, entrance test scores, photo).
- Send the form offline to the administration office or by post.
- For merit-based seats, register on KEA (https://kea.kar.nic.in) or COMEDK (https://www.comedk.org) for counselling.
- Confirm the allotted seat at Shri Krishna Institute of Technology's admission office.
Shri Krishna Institute of Technology Placement
Shri Krishna Institute of Technology’s Training and Placement Cell supports students with industry exposure through programs like Infosys Campus Connect, Aricent’s JAVA training, and Pramathi’s Wave Maker. The highest package is INR 8 LPA, with an average of INR 5 LPA. Recruiters include TCS, Infosys, and Wipro.

Shri Krishna Institute of Technology Campus Facilities
Shri Krishna Institute of Technology's Chimney Hills campus provides a peaceful learning environment with state-of-the-art infrastructure, including well-furnished laboratories (e.g., Data Structures, Computer Graphics), a library with 25,200 books and 48 journals, Wi-Fi, and a 300-capacity auditorium. Hostels, a hygienic cafeteria, a medical centre with connections to Raghavendra PEOPLE TREE Hospital, and transport facilities are some of the other amenities provided.

Shri Krishna Institute of Technology Scholarships
Fee concession is given by Shri Krishna Institute of Technology, and state and central government scholarships are also facilitated, like the National Scholarship for Non-Karnataka Students. Forms are provided at the administrative office in September every year.
